Quantum physics has gone through two major revolutions over the past century, which has transformed how we understand and practise theoretical physics. But what has still been left unanswered through these revolutions?

Theoretical physicist Ross Jenkinson joins us this month to explain the impact of both of these revolutions on quantum science, and specifically how quantum field theory and quantum computing could help to explain one of the biggest obstacles in quantum physics: gravity. Ross also uncovers the realities of working with quantum computers and how these underground labs actually work.
